小编Ome*_*r K的帖子

无法打开数据库,因为它是版本782.此服务器支持版本706及更早版本.不支持降级路径

我使用SQL Server 2014 Express创建了一个示例数据库,并将其添加到我的Windows窗体解决方案中.双击它打开我得到这个错误.

无法打开数据库,因为它是版本782.此服务器支持版本706及更早版本.不支持降级路径

我正在使用Visual Studio 2013.我真的不明白我使用的是两个最新版本的Microsoft产品,它们是不兼容的.我错过了什么吗?我该如何打开这个数据库?

在此输入图像描述

sql-server visual-studio

83
推荐指数
2
解决办法
10万
查看次数

缓存与会话的优点

在Session和Cache中存储数据表有什么区别?有哪些优点和缺点?

因此,如果它是一个简单的搜索页面,它返回数据表中的结果并将其绑定到gridview.如果用户'a'搜索并且用户'b'搜索,是否最好将其存储在Session中,因为每个用户很可能会有不同的结果,或者我仍然可以将他们的每个搜索存储在缓存中,或者这是否有意义,因为有只有一个缓存.我想基本上我想说的是Cache会被覆盖.

c# asp.net viewstate session caching

67
推荐指数
6
解决办法
7万
查看次数

未找到实用程序文件。请在首选项对话框中配置二进制路径

因此,当我必须使用 dvdrental 名称恢复数据库时,我按照 Jose Portilla 的 Udemy 课程在我的 PC 上设置 PostgreSQL。它显示了消息

`Please configure the PostgreSQL Binary Path in the Preferences dialog.
Run Code Online (Sandbox Code Playgroud)

我现在该怎么办?感谢任何和所有帮助

sql postgresql pgadmin-4

52
推荐指数
2
解决办法
13万
查看次数

无法加载文件或程序集“System.Runtime,版本 = 7.0.0.0...” - 安装 .NET Core 7 后“dotnet watch run”不起作用

.Net 7.0更新后,当我使用时dotnet watch run出现此错误:

未处理的异常。System.IO.FileNotFoundException:无法加载文件或程序集“System.Runtime,版本= 7.0.0.0,文化=中性,PublicKeyToken = b03f5f7f11d50a3a”。该系统找不到指定的文件。文件名:'System.Runtime,Version=7.0.0.0,Culture=neutral,PublicKeyToken=b03f5f7f11d50a3a' at System.Reflection.RuntimeAssembly.GetType(QCallAssembly程序集,字符串名称,布尔值 throwOnError,布尔值ignoreCase,ObjectHandleOnStack类型,ObjectHandleOnStack keepAlive,ObjectHandleOnStack assemblyLoadContext) 在 System.Reflection.RuntimeAssembly.GetType(String name, Boolean throwOnError, BooleanignoreCase) 在 System.Reflection.Assembly.GetType(String name, Boolean throwOnError) 在 System.StartupHookProvider.CallStartupHook(StartupHookNameOrPathstartupHook) 在 System.StartupHookProvider。进程启动钩子()

我可以使用 Visual Studio 成功构建并运行该项目,但无法使用dotnet cli。如何修复此错误?

.net c# dotnet-cli .net-7.0

44
推荐指数
3
解决办法
3万
查看次数

SqlCommand with using语句

我看到在大多数样本中,SqlCommand都是这样使用的

using (SqlConnection con = new SqlConnection(CNN_STRING))
{
    using (SqlCommand cmd = new SqlCommand("Select ID,Name From Person", con))
    {
        SqlDataAdapter da = new SqlDataAdapter(cmd);
        DataSet ds = new DataSet();
        da.Fill(ds);           
        return ds;
    }
}
Run Code Online (Sandbox Code Playgroud)

我知道为什么我们使用"使用"声明.但是SqlCommand没有包含Close()方法,所以我们应该在using语句中使用它

c# sqlcommand sqlconnection using-statement

20
推荐指数
2
解决办法
3万
查看次数

18
推荐指数
2
解决办法
2万
查看次数

源端口与目标端口

我是TCP/IP的新手,并努力学习基础知识.好吧,我真的很想知道防火墙的入站规则和出站规则以及源地址的概念:端口,目标地址:端口.

例如,我正在调查端口80.我知道http使用端口80.但是当我尝试监听流量时,我看到我的浏览器不使用80.正如您从图像中看到的那样,仅使用目标端口80并且"目的地"应该是托管网页而不是我的计算机的服务器.并且在源端口上没有使用端口80,"源"应该是我的计算机.

在此输入图像描述

我的浏览器使用其他一些端口作为源并转到服务器端口80.从中我知道我的计算机的端口80不用于http,只有托管网页的服务器计算机使用端口80但是如果我关闭端口80或我的电脑从出站规则互联网不起作用.但正如我之前从图像中理解的那样,我的计算机上没有使用端口80.

真的很困惑.有人可以为我澄清一下吗?

port firewall tcp

12
推荐指数
1
解决办法
5万
查看次数

IIS托管的WCF服务返回HTTP 400错误请求

我一直在寻找几个小时,但我找不到解决方案.我将简要解释一下.

我正在学习WCF服务.我刚刚创建了一个服务并浏览它.这是配置文件:

<?xml version="1.0"?>
<configuration>
  <system.serviceModel>
    <behaviors>
      <serviceBehaviors>
        <behavior name="EmployeeServiceBehaviour">
          <serviceMetadata httpGetEnabled="true" />
          <serviceDebug includeExceptionDetailInFaults="true" />
        </behavior>
      </serviceBehaviors>
    </behaviors>
    <services>
      <service behaviorConfiguration="EmployeeServiceBehaviour" name="EmployeeConfiguration">
        <endpoint address="http://localhost:2005/EmployeeService.svc" binding="basicHttpBinding"
          bindingConfiguration="" contract="IEmployeeConfiguration" />
      </service>
    </services>
  </system.serviceModel>
  <system.web>
    <compilation debug="true"/>
  </system.web>
  <system.webServer>
    <directoryBrowse enabled="true"/>
  </system.webServer>
</configuration>
Run Code Online (Sandbox Code Playgroud)

从Visual Studio浏览它似乎没有问题.它完美地运作.

在此输入图像描述

在此输入图像描述

其次,我试图在IIS上发布它.我在做什么是这样的:

我将服务发布到一个文件夹,并将此服务添加到IIS.

在此输入图像描述

我选择端口3006作为端口.

在它的配置文件下面.请注意,我还将配置中的端口更改为3006

<?xml version="1.0"?>
<configuration>
  <system.serviceModel>
    <behaviors>
      <serviceBehaviors>
        <behavior name="EmployeeServiceBehaviour">
          <serviceMetadata httpGetEnabled="true" />
          <serviceDebug includeExceptionDetailInFaults="true" />
        </behavior>
      </serviceBehaviors>
    </behaviors>
    <services>
      <service behaviorConfiguration="EmployeeServiceBehaviour" name="EmployeeConfiguration">
        <endpoint address="http://localhost:3006/EmployeeService.svc" binding="basicHttpBinding"
          bindingConfiguration="" contract="IEmployeeConfiguration" />
      </service>
    </services>
  </system.serviceModel>
  <system.web>
    <compilation/>
  </system.web> …
Run Code Online (Sandbox Code Playgroud)

c# asp.net iis wcf

12
推荐指数
1
解决办法
2万
查看次数

如何在Visual Studio中使用SSDT重命名表

我正在使用visual studio 2013并尝试学习本地数据库操作.我使用VS和创建表创建了一个数据库.但我不能重命名表名.在任何地方都没有这样的选择,或者我看不到.我搜索但什么也没找到.

谁能告诉我如何使用'VISUAL STUDIO 2013 SSDT'重命名表格

在此输入图像描述

sql visual-studio local-database sql-server-data-tools

10
推荐指数
1
解决办法
2754
查看次数

EntityDataSource和Entity Framework 6

我正在学习ASP.NET.我来到EntityDataSorce控件.我正在使用EF6.我已经读过这个控件和EF6有一些问题,冲突,但随着对EntityDataSource的最后更新,这个问题已经解决了.http://blogs.msdn.com/b/webdev/archive/2014/02/28/announcing-the-release-of-dynamic-data-provider-and-entitydatasource-control-for-entity-framework-6. ASPX

我试图按照上面的链接.首先,我创建一个.edmx模型

在此输入图像描述

使用NuGet安装新的EntityDataSource Contro

在此输入图像描述

我添加了两个EntityDataSource控件,并将其中一个的前缀更改为ef.所以我有两个控件,其中一个是旧的,另一个是新的更新

在此输入图像描述

当我点击旧的时,我可以看到配置弹出窗口并进入配置数据源屏幕.但是当点击新的时,没有弹出窗口.那么,我该如何配置数据源呢?这有什么问题?

在此输入图像描述

Web.config文件

    <?xml version="1.0"?>
<!--
  For more information on how to configure your ASP.NET application, please visit
  http://go.microsoft.com/fwlink/?LinkId=169433
  -->
<configuration>
  <configSections>
    <!-- For more information on Entity Framework configuration, visit http://go.microsoft.com/fwlink/?LinkID=237468 -->
    <section name="entityFramework" type="System.Data.Entity.Internal.ConfigFile.EntityFrameworkSection, EntityFramework, Version=6.0.0.0, Culture=neutral, PublicKeyToken=b77a5c561934e089" requirePermission="false"/>
  </configSections>
  <system.web>
    <compilation debug="true" targetFramework="4.5">
      <assemblies>
        <add assembly="System.Web.Entity, Version=4.0.0.0, Culture=neutral, PublicKeyToken=B77A5C561934E089"/>
        <add assembly="System.Data.Entity, Version=4.0.0.0, Culture=neutral, PublicKeyToken=B77A5C561934E089"/>
      </assemblies>
    </compilation>
    <httpRuntime targetFramework="4.5"/>
    <pages>
      <controls>
        <add tagPrefix="ef" assembly="Microsoft.AspNet.EntityDataSource" namespace="Microsoft.AspNet.EntityDataSource"/>
      </controls>
    </pages>
  </system.web>
  <connectionStrings>
    <add name="SampleDbEntities" connectionString="metadata=res://*/Model1.csdl|res://*/Model1.ssdl|res://*/Model1.msl;provider=System.Data.SqlClient;provider …
Run Code Online (Sandbox Code Playgroud)

c# asp.net entity-framework entity-framework-6

9
推荐指数
1
解决办法
2万
查看次数